Step-by-Step Guide to Programming Your Universal Remote

Now that you have everything prepared, let’s dive into the actual programming process. The following sections will detail two methods for programming your universal remote to your Sanyo TV: the Manual Code Entry Method and the Auto Search Method.

Method 1: Manual Code Entry Method

The Manual Code Entry Method involves entering a specific code for your Sanyo TV into the universal remote. Follow these steps carefully:

Step 1: Turn on Your Sanyo TV

Switch on your Sanyo TV using the power button located on the TV itself, or use your existing remote if you still have it.

Step 2: Prepare Your Universal Remote

Locate the ‘Code Search’ button on your universal remote. You may also need to identify the button labeled for the device you are programming (usually labeled ‘TV’).

Step 3: Enter Code Search Mode

  • Press and hold the ‘Code Search’ button until the red indicator stays on.
  • Release the ‘Code Search’ button. The red indicator will blink and then turn off.

Step 4: Program Your Sanyo TV

  • Press and release the button for the device you are programming (in this case, ‘TV’).
  • The red indicator will blink and then turn off.

Step 5: Enter the Sanyo TV Code

Now, you need to enter the code specific to your Sanyo TV model. Here is a table of commonly used Sanyo TV codes for universal remotes:

Brand Universal Remote Code
Sanyo 001, 002, 003, 004, 005
  • Using the number buttons on your remote, enter the three-digit code for your Sanyo TV.
  • If the code is entered correctly, the red indicator will turn off.

Step 6: Test the Remote

Try using your universal remote to turn the volume up and down or change the channels. If the remote works properly, you have successfully programmed it to your Sanyo TV!

Step 7: Repeat as Necessary

If your universal remote doesn’t control your Sanyo TV, repeat the process using the next code listed for your brand.

Method 2: Auto Search Method

If the manual code entry does not work, you can use the Auto Search method, which allows the universal remote to search for the correct code automatically.

Step 1: Turn on Your Sanyo TV

Make sure your Sanyo TV is powered on.

Step 2: Prepare Your Universal Remote

Same as in the first method, locate the ‘Code Search’ button on your universal remote.

Step 3: Enter Code Search Mode

  • Press and hold the ‘Code Search’ button until the red indicator stays on.
  • Release the ‘Code Search’ button, and the red indicator will blink and turn off.

Step 4: Start Auto Search

  • Press and release the button labeled for the device you wish to program (in this case, ‘TV’).
  • The red indicator will blink and turn off.

  • Press and release the ‘Power’ button repeatedly until the TV turns off. This could take several attempts.

Step 5: Store the Code

Once your TV turns off, press the ‘Enter’ button to store the code. The red indicator will turn off, confirming you’ve successfully programmed the remote.

Step 6: Test the Remote

After programming through the Auto Search method, test to see if your universal remote can successfully control your Sanyo TV. Adjust the volume, change the channel, or turn the TV on and off to confirm.

What features can I control on my Sanyo TV with a universal remote?

When properly programmed, a universal remote can control various features of your Sanyo TV just like the original remote. This includes common functions such as turning the TV on and off, adjusting the volume, changing channels, and accessing the TV menu. Many universal remotes also allow for one-touch access to popular features like sleep timers and picture settings.

Additionally, some advanced universal remotes come with programmable macro buttons, enabling you to perform a series of commands with a single button press. For instance, you could set a macro that turns on the TV, switches the input to HDMI, and sets the volume to a preset level, enhancing your viewing experience without needing to juggle multiple remotes.
